What is Affiliate Marketing?
Affiliate marketing can be a performance-based web marketing strategy where individuals (affiliates) promote products or services from a company (merchant) through various online channels. When someone decides to buy something or completes a desired action (like registering for a newsletter) from the affiliate’s unique referral link, the affiliate earns a commission.

Types of Affiliate Marketing Jobs for Beginners
1. Content Creator
Role: As a content creator, you produce blog posts, videos, podcasts, or social websites content that incorporates affiliate links. The goal is always to provide valuable information while subtly promoting services or products.

How to Get Started:

Choose a Niche: Focus on a specific area of interest, like fitness, technology, or beauty, to draw a targeted audience.
Create a Blog or YouTube Channel: Start a blog or YouTube channel where one can share content in connection with your niche. Use affiliate links to recommend products.
Join Affiliate Programs: Sign up for relevant affiliate products, for example Amazon Associates, ShareASale, or Commission Junction, gain access to products to market.
Tips for Success:

Provide honest and helpful reviews to build trust along with your audience.
Optimize your articles for SEO to get organic traffic.
Consistently produce high-quality content to keep your audience engaged.

3. Email Marketer
Role: Email marketers promote products through email campaigns. This involves building a contact list and sending targeted messages offering affiliate links to encourage subscribers to make a purchase.

How to Get Started:

Build an Email List: Use a lead magnet, such as a free e-book or guide, to get subscribers for a email list.
Choose an Email Marketing Platform: Platforms like Mailchimp, ConvertKit, or AWeber allow you to create and send email campaigns.
Create Engaging Emails: Write persuasive emails that offer value for your subscribers while promoting affiliate programs.
Tips for Success:

Segment your optin list to send targeted offers determined by subscribers’ interests.
Use compelling subject lines to raise open rates.
Track your campaigns to view what works and optimize future emails.

5. PPC Affiliate Marketer
Role: PPC (Pay-Per-Click) online marketers use paid advertising to drive traffic to affiliate offers. This involves creating and managing ad campaigns on platforms like Google Ads, Facebook Ads, or Bing Ads.

How to Get Started:

Learn the Basics of PPC: Understand how PPC advertising works, including keyword research, ad creation, and bidding strategies.
Choose a Niche: Focus on a unique product category or industry where one can create effective ad campaigns.
Join High-Paying Affiliate Programs: Look for affiliate programs that offer high commissions to be sure profitability from the ads.
Tips for Success:

Start with a small budget and test different ad variations to view what works.
Use tracking tools to appraise the performance of your respective campaigns.
Continuously optimize your ads to boost ROI.
